body
{ 
    font-family: verdana;
    color: #311418;
    font-size:8pt;
    background: url(../../images/template_iframe/index_5.gif) repeat-x;
	background-color:#E2DED4;
  
}

.BgColorText{
    color:#6f635c;
}
.BgColorText2{
    color:#6f635c;
}
    
td
{font-size:8pt;
 font-family: verdana;
 }

th
{ font-size:11px;
 font-weight:bold;
 padding:2px 2px 2px 2px;}
 
.th{font-size:12px; font-weight:normal; padding:2px 2px 2px 2px; text-align:left; }
i{color:#336699;}
b, .bold{font-weight:bold;}

/*input and select styles are specified in skin files*/
/*input, select {font-size: 12px; font-family: verdana; border: 1px solid; background-color: #dddddd;}*/

img{border:none; border-width:0px;}

h1, .h1{    font-size: 18pt;    font-weight: normal;    color: #597575;}    
h2, .h2{	font-size: 16pt;	font-weight: normal;	color: #597575;}
h3, .h3{    font-size: 14pt;    font-weight: normal;    color: #597575;}	
h4, .h4{	font-size: 12pt;	font-weight: normal;	color: #597575;}
h5, .h5{	font-size: 11pt;	font-weight: normal;	color: #597575;}
h6, .h6{	font-size: 10pt;	font-weight: normal;	color: #597575;}

a
{
	color: #996666;
	text-decoration: none;
}
a:hover{color: #CC0000; text-decoration:underline;}

a.Bold{color: #353535;  text-decoration:none; font-weight:bold;}
a:hover.Bold{color: #CC0000; text-decoration:underline; font-weight:bold;} 

a.White{	color: #ffffff;  text-decoration:none; font-family:Verdana; font-size:9px;}
a:hover.White{color: #DDDDDD; text-decoration:underline; font-family:Verdana; font-size:9px;}

a:link.WhiteBold{color: #ffffff;  text-decoration:none; font-weight:bold;}
a:hover.WhiteBold{color: #DDDDDD; text-decoration:underline; font-weight:bold;}

a:link.Gray{color: gray;  text-decoration:none;}
a:hover.Gray{color: #33aa00; text-decoration:underline;}

a:link.Info{color: Orange;  text-decoration:none; font-family:Verdana; font-size:9px;}
a:hover.Info{color: #ee6633; text-decoration:underline; font-family:Verdana; font-size:9px;}

.ErrorText{color:#CC0000; font-weight:bold; font-size:12px}
.ErrorTextMedium{color: #CC0000; font-weight: bold; font-size:14px;}

.InfoText{color: #9a9a9a;font-size: 14px;}
.InfoTextMedium{color: #9a9a9a;	font-size: 16px;}

.GrayText, .Gray{color: Gray; font-size:11px; letter-spacing:0px;}
.WhiteText, .White{color: white; font-size:11px; letter-spacing:0px;}
.WhiteTextMedium{color: white; font-weight: bold;	font-size: 14px;}

.Highlight
{
	font-weight: bold;
	font-size: 12px;
	background-color:#efefef;
	background-image: url(images/template_home/highlightedback.jpg);
	background-repeat: repeat-x;
	padding: 7px 2px 7px 4px;
}

.Box
{
	border-right: solid 1px #9a9a9a;
	border-top: solid 1px #9a9a9a;
	border-left: solid 1px #9a9a9a;
	border-bottom: solid 1px #9a9a9a;
	vertical-align:top;
	padding: 10px 5px 10px 5px;
}

.BoxFilled
{
	border-right: solid 1px #9a9a9a;
	border-top: solid 1px #9a9a9a;
	border-left: solid 1px #9a9a9a;
	border-bottom: solid 1px #9a9a9a;
	vertical-align:top;
	padding: 10px 10px 10px 10px;
	text-align:justify;
	background-color:#efefef;
}

.HomeDarkHeading
{
	font-family: Tahoma;
	font-size: 11pt;
	color: #7DDa01;
	letter-spacing:1.5;
	font-weight:bold;
}

.RightAligned, .Right{text-align:right; padding-right:10;}
.CenterAligned, .Center{text-align:center;}
.LeftAligned, .Left{text-align:left;}

.ImgAddToCart{background-image: url('/images/buttons/add-to-cart.gif');}

.BreadCrumb{ background-color:#efefef; color:Red; padding-left:4px; padding-bottom:2px;}

.GridHeader
{
	font-weight: bold;
	font-size: larger; /*background-image: url(../../images/template_adm/center_2.jpg);*/
	font-family: arial;
	height: 24px;
	text-align: left;
	color: #efefef;
	font-size: 12px;
	background-position: right center;
	background-color: #336699;
}

.GridItem
{	
	background-color: #e8e6e0;
	color: #454545;
	border: solid 1px #c9c4b7;
}
 .AltGridItem
{
   background-color: #e8e6e0;
	color: #454545;
	border: solid 1px #c9c4b7;
 }
.Grid{background-color:#e8e6e0; color:#454545;}
    .GridItem a, .Grid a  {color:#800000; text-decoration:none;}    
    .GridItem a:hover, .Grid a:hover{color:#CC0000; text-decoration:underline;}
  


.FeaturedVisitation
{   
    background-color:Transparent;
    width:209px;
    text-align:center;
    }
.FeaturedVisitationImage
{
   background-color:Transparent;    
    background-position: center 50%;
}    
    	

.Top5Visitation
{      
   background-color:#E2DED4;
   
    width:100%;
    color: #225588;
}

.RecInfo
{ color: #885522;   
    }
    
    
.Iframe
{
 width:450px;
 /*background: url(../../images/template_iframe/index_5.gif) repeat-x;
 background-color:#E2DED4;*/
    }